How do I program my Honeywell Ademco Vista 20P?

The first step when programming a Vista-20P is to enter programming mode. You can do this by entering your [Installer Code] + [8] + [00]. The default installer code on a Honeywell Vista-20P is 4112. If you have lost your installer code, you can alternatively use the backdoor method to get into programming.

How do I program my Vista panel?

You should be able to power down the panel, power it back up, and within 50 seconds, press the asterisk (*) and pound (#) keys to get you into programming. If you enter programming, you should see a 20 displayed on the keypad. Press *20, then enter your 4-digit master code.

How do I program my Ademco alarm system?

Go to a keypad, and within 60 seconds of power-up, press the “*” and “#” keys at the same time. This will put the panel into programming mode. The display should show either “00” or “20”, indicating program mode. If not, repeat the power-off /power-up steps and try again.

How do I change the master code on Ademco Vista 20p?

  1. [Current Master Code] + [8] + [02] + [New Master Code] + [New Master Code Again]
  2. The keypad will produce a long tone to confirm that the code has been successfully changed.
  3. Test the code. …
  4. [New Master Code] + [3]
  5. The system should begin to arm. …
  6. [New Master Code] + [1]

What is installer code?

The Installer Code (also called Program Code or Dealer Code depending on brand) is a special code used to access system configuration settings so a user can add sensors/zones, change delay times, modify central station telephone numbers and account numbers. … These codes can arm and disarm the system and bypass zones.

How do I reset my Vista 20p installer code?

First reset the installer code by pressing *20 followed by the 4 digit Installer code you wish to use. You will hear a beep after each digit entry, and 3 beeps after the final entry. You can reset other user codes once you know the installer code. After completing programming, it is important to use *99 to exit.

Why does my Ademco alarm keep beeping?

Most alarm systems have a backup battery that kicks in if the power ever goes out. When the battery is low or dead in an old alarm system, the system will start beeping to alert you that it needs to be replaced. If your battery is low, it will either need to be disconnected or replaced.

What does the code FC mean on my alarm system?

The FC code stands for “failed to communicate.” It means the security system isn’t communicating well with the security company.

How do I reset my master code on Vista 10SE?

  1. Enter Master Code then press 8.
  2. Press 2.
  3. Enter new Master Code twice.
  4. Keypad beeps if successful.

How do I reset my Honeywell alarm system?

  1. Unplug the transformer from the power source.
  2. Disconnect the battery.
  3. Plug the transformer back in.
  4. Reconnect the battery.
  5. Within 30 seconds of turning the alarm system on, press * and # at the same time. …
  6. Enter *20.
  7. Enter a new 4 digit installer code. …
  8. Press *99 to exit programming mode.

How do I reset my Honeywell alarm without master code?

You can program a Honeywell Alarm with no Master Code by using the Installer Code. The Master Code is not used for programming a Honeywell Security System. Only the Installer Code can be used to program the system. Additionally, the Installer Code can reset the Master Code if needed.
